Transaction 6aedd7911fdef7a97492d6ca0398fd2a80d4956a35725b37dd2916ff1d634221

2 Input
2 Outputs
  • 6aedd7911fdef7a97492d6ca0398fd2a80d4956a35725b37dd2916ff1d634221:0
  • value  17000000
    address  3G8UCQnviPFuc9rsDhcSZLTfNLgpYbL1pd
  • 6aedd7911fdef7a97492d6ca0398fd2a80d4956a35725b37dd2916ff1d634221:1
  • value  4792229
    address  3L72vpxEMXNfH6wqcximSepiyTZQGDCg7H